Output 58f223fb8fe5543f2068445df77c33e74855e48d0a9074f0ff34b45d276ec201:1

value
291589
script pubkey
OP_0 OP_PUSHBYTES_20 ce86971ad7cf392af8ddf4be178b87e399acc172
address
tb1qe6rfwxkheuuj47xa7jlp0zu8uwv6estj9xkexz
transaction
58f223fb8fe5543f2068445df77c33e74855e48d0a9074f0ff34b45d276ec201